Earth Week Keynote address: Judy Wicks will be speaking at 7:00 p.m., Sunday April 20 for the Local Living Economies Earth Week Kickoff . Judy will be speaking on her experience in creating
sustainable community business through the White Dog Cafe, her famous
restaurant in Philadelphia and the growing success of sustainable businesses around the world. A Reception will begin at 6 pm. At 8 a.m. Monday, April 21 Judy Wicks will kick off the morning with a Business Breakfast for the Green and Local Business Mini-Conference. Judy will discuss the Business Alliance for Local Living Economies, the global network of local business associations she co-founded. | About Judy Wicks Judy Wicks is the world class
business owner of the White Dog Cafe, a visionary social
entrepreneur and co-founder of the Business Alliance for Local Living Economies and the Philadelphia Sustainable Business Network, an advisory board
member of the American Independent Business Alliance, and one of the
great champions of Green and Local business! Judy is an internationally known and inspiring speaker, networker and vision-keeper for a positive, sustainable future. We are honored to have her with us for this year's Earth Day!
